From Sarah Kate Photo…We teamed with the best of the best for these floral DIY altars. Alicia and Abigail with Bows & Arrows each put together one altar for a DIY tutorial and then we photographed a beautiful model with the outcome!
Floral snips
Foraged greenery
Seasonal blooms
Paddle wire
2 large urns
2 sturdy rods
Place urns at the width of your choosing and then place rods inside the urns.
Start at the base and begin to wrap your greenery around the rod to the fullness of your liking, and secure with paddle wire. When you reach the top, find a branch with a natural curve to give the illusion that the arch connects.
